#734538 Hex Color Code

#734538

The Hexadecimal Color #734538 is a contrast shade of Saddle Brown. #734538 RGB value is rgb(115, 69, 56). RGB Color Model of #734538 consists of 45% red, 27% green and 21% blue. HSL color Mode of #734538 has 13°(degrees) Hue, 35% Saturation and 34% Lightness. #734538 color has an wavelength of 611.81481n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#734538 is #996666.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#734538 is #743. The Closest Color to #734538 is #8B4513. Official Name of #734538 Hex Code is Old Copper.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#734538 is 0 Cyan 40 Magenta 51 Yellow 55 Black and #734538 CMY is 0, 40, 51.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#734538 is hsl(13,35,34,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(13, 51, 45).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#734538 is 9.91, 8.19, 4.8.
Hex8 Value of #734538 is #734538FF. Decimal Value of #734538 is 7554360 and Octal Value of #734538 is 34642470. Binary Value of #734538 is 1110011, 1000101, 111000 and Android of #734538 is 4285744440 / 0xff734538.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#734538 is 0.433, 0.358, 0.358 and YIQ Color Space of #734538 is 81.272, 31.5883, 5.6834.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#734538 is 10.0, 6.96, 4.86.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#734538 is 34.38, 18.2, 16.2.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#734538 is 34.38, 31.96, 14.54.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#734538 is 34.38, 24.37, 41.67. Hunter Lab variable of #734538 is 28.62, 11.73, 10.09.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#734538

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
